9. Brown living room paint

If you're looking to refresh your living room without breaking the bank, painting the walls is a great option. Brown living room paint can add warmth and depth to your space. You can also use different paint techniques, such as a faux finish or ombre effect, to add texture and interest to your walls.

When choosing a brown paint for your living room, consider the undertones. Some shades of brown may have red or orange undertones, while others may have green or blue undertones. You want to choose a shade that complements your existing furniture and decor.

Choosing the Right Shade of Brown

brown living room s The first step to creating a brown living room is choosing the right shade of brown. There are a variety of shades to choose from, ranging from light beige to deep chocolate. Lighter shades of brown are perfect for creating a soft and airy feel, while dark shades of brown can add a sense of warmth and richness to the room. It's important to consider the natural lighting in your living room and choose a shade that complements it. For example, if your living room receives a lot of natural light, a darker shade of brown may make the space feel too dark and cramped.

Layering Textures

brown living room s One of the best ways to add dimension to a brown living room is by layering different textures. This not only adds visual interest but also creates a cozy and inviting atmosphere. Start with a plush brown area rug as the foundation of the room and then layer on different textures such as knit blankets, velvet pillows, and woven baskets . You can also incorporate different textures through the use of materials like wood, leather, and jute in your furniture and decor pieces.

Accents of Color

brown living room s While brown may be the main color in your living room, it's important to add accents of color to prevent the space from feeling too monochromatic. Warm colors like mustard yellow, burnt orange, and deep red complement brown beautifully and can be incorporated through throw pillows, curtains, or wall art. You can also add a pop of color through greenery in the form of plants and flowers , which not only adds color but also brings a touch of nature into the space.
